Pavel Stehule wrote:
> On 01/11/2007, Tom Lane <tgl(at)sss(dot)pgh(dot)pa(dot)us> wrote:
> > "Pavel Stehule" <pavel(dot)stehule(at)gmail(dot)com> writes:
> > > When I try manually rebuild cluster I had second problem:
> >
> > > C:\PostgreSQL\bin>initdb -D ../data
> > > The program "postgres" is needed by initdb but was not found in the
> > > same directory as "C:\PostgreSQL\bin/initdb".
> > > Check your installation.
> >
> > Do you have the same problem previously reported that "postgres -V"
> > doesn't work? If so, maybe taking out libxml2 will help?
> No, it is different problem. It was my beginner mistake :(. I run
> initdb as Administrator. It needs maybe some hint message. With runas
> initdb works.
IMHO we should check for an Administrator user and reject it
explicitely. The error message is way too obscure.
